Zika Virus Declared a Public Health Emergency of International Concern

The WHO Director General, Dr Margaret Chan, convened an Emergency Committee made up of 18 experts and advisers, under the International Health Regulations, “to gather advice on the severity of the health threat associated with the continuing spread of Zika virus disease in Latin America and the Caribbean” on 1 February.

In assessing the level of threat, the Committee “looked in particular at the strong association, in time and place, between infection with the Zika virus and a rise in detected cases of congenital malformations and neurological complications.”...

Secretary-General Appoints High-Level Group for Every Woman Every Child

The UN Secretary-General Ban Ki-moon has announced the first members of the High-level Advisory Group for Every Woman Every Child (EWEC). They will help provide leadership for women's, children's and adolescents' health during the transition from the Millennium Development Goals (MDGs) to the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s). Michelle Bachelet Jeria, President of Chile, and Hailemariam Dessalegn, Prime Minister of Ethiopia, are the co-chairs for the Group, with Tarja Halonen, former President of the Republic of Finland, and Jakaya Mrisho Kikwete, former President of Tanzania, as alternate Co-Chairs...

General Assembly Briefing on Global Indicator Framework, 28 January 2016

President: Mr. Mogens Lykketoft in opening the briefing, referred to his letter of 14 January 2016 on the report of the Interagency and Expert Group (IAEG) on indicators to the Statistical Commission, which includes the list of indicators in Annex. They have been developed through an open and inclusive consultative list. Most of the indicators have been agreed, with the exception of those marked with an *, which need further work. The Group is still working on them and will be submitting its updated proposals in an addendum to the report for the report. Once the report of the IAEG has been agreed by the Statistical Commission, the indicator framework will go to ECOSOC and General Assembly for adoption

Member States were invited to register any further questions or concerns, so that they can be addressed before the Commission meets...

Report of the Secretary-General on critical milestones towards coherent, efficient and inclusive follow-up and review at the global level

The unedited version of the Report of the Secretary-General on critical milestones towards coherent, efficient and inclusive follow-up and review at the global level is now available. It has been prepared in response to paragraph 90 of the 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development for consideration at the 70th session of UN General Assembly, the explores how to put in place a “coherent, efficient and inclusive follow-up and review system at the global level,” within the mandates outlined in the 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development. 

Below is an account of the main suggestions for the work of the High-level Political Forum, drawing particular attention to those that relate to the Voluntary National Reviews, the role of the General Assembly, the ECOSOC and its functional commissions (which include the Commission on the Status of Women and the Commission on Population and Development) and the Regional Commissions. Also included in detail are suggestions that relate to the work of Major Groups and other Stakeholders...

UN Secretary General appoints Sustainable Development Goal Advocates

The UN Secretary-General has appointed Sustainable Development Goal (SDG) Advocates, including Queen Mathilde of Belgium, the Crown Princess Victoria of Sweden, Shakira, Jeffrey Sachs, and Messi to help generate momentum and commitment to achieve the SDGs by 2030. The Advocates' tasks, according to the Secretary-General include promoting the 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development, raising awareness of the integrated nature of the SDGs, and fostering the engagement of new stakeholders in implementing the SDGs.

The Co-chairs for the Group are John Dramani Mahama, President of Ghana, and Erna Solberg, Prime Minister of Norway. Its members include Heads of State and Government, business and political leaders, prominent academia, and others who have shown leadership in their fields.
